> If start of any DRAM bank is greater than total DDR size, remaining
> DDR banks' start address & size were left un-initialized in dram_init
> function. This could break other functions who uses array
> 'gd->bd->bi_dram'. Kirkwood network driver is one example. This also
> stops Linux kernel from booting.
> 
> v2 - Set start address also to 0. Without this Linux kernel couldn't
> boot up

Hi Prafulla,

Gray's patch takes care of ram size in u-boot. But still with his patch non-contiguous memory would be exposed -if it's there - to Linux kernel by start and size variables of bi_dram. My patch takes care of that by zeroing these variables. What's your opinion?
